Sunni Endowments announces mosques for Eid Al Adha prayer

Manama, June 22 (BNA): Chairman of the Sunni Endowments Council, Dr. Sheikh Rashid bin Muhammad Al-Hajri, announced that Eid Al-Adha prayers will be held at 5:07 am on the first day of Eid.

And the endowments affirmed the readiness of Eid mosques throughout Bahrain to receive worshipers.

Eleven mosques will be allocated to non-Arabic speaking communities in all governorates of the Kingdom of Bahrain.

The Sunni Endowments Council said that it had prepared and equipped Eid mosques with furniture, equipment and supplies necessary to receive worshipers.
